Serbo-Croatian edit

Etymology 1 edit

Inherited from Proto-Slavic *leťi, from Proto-Balto-Slavic *legtei, from Proto-Indo-European *légʰeti, from *legʰ- (to lie).

Verb edit

lȅći pf (Cyrillic spelling ле̏ћи)

  1. (intransitive) to lie down
  2. (intransitive) to fit (+u (in) or na (on)) (match by size and shape)

Verb edit

lȇći impf (Cyrillic spelling ле̑ћи)

  1. (intransitive) to hatch, brood (keep an egg warm to make it hatch)
